Zaloguj się by uzyskać pełen dostęp. Nie masz jeszcze konta? Założ je już teraz w kilka sekund.

Wysłany: 2012-05-21, 15:09


luki123luki123

Place Game






Wiek: 28
Na forum: 5275 dni
Posty: 1948
Nick w MP: LuKiO

Piwa: 6101

Respekt: 611
Respekt: 611Respekt: 611

Ej robie teraz panel salonu i nie wiem jak robi? z XML skryptu da kto? mi przyk?ad

Postaw piwo autorowi tego posta
 

 
Wysłany: 2012-05-22, 22:30


BugMeNot







Wiek: 43
Na forum: 5154 dni
Posty: 10
Nick w MP: Mr.Tajemniczy

Piwa: 1

Respekt: 50

Ej no ja rozumie twoja wypowiedz dobrze bardzo bo joda mistrz uk?adania zda? uczy? mnie.

Mo?e wyja?nij o co ci chodzi?

Postaw piwo autorowi tego posta
 

 
Wysłany: 2012-05-23, 00:03


Piorun







Wiek: 32
Na forum: 6712 dni
Posty: 1837
Nick w MP: Piorun

Piwa: 516

Respekt: 480,7
Respekt: 480,7

Chce si? bawi? wczytywaniem plik?w XML, czyli kr?cej - wczytywanie danych z pliku do skryptu (oj, chyba jednak nie kr?cej).

Podpis
Możesz mnie znaleźć na: Facebook
Postaw piwo autorowi tego posta
 

 
Wysłany: 2012-05-23, 15:18


luki123luki123

Place Game






Wiek: 28
Na forum: 5275 dni
Posty: 1948
Nick w MP: LuKiO

Piwa: 6101

Respekt: 611
Respekt: 611Respekt: 611

Pioruniasty, ja chce z XML wczytywa? pliki na serwer np.Kupno broni masz
id="31" kasa="1000">Ak47</>


o takie co? mi chodzi zeby wczytywa?o na serwer jak? bro? ma da? i ile kasy ma zabra? i da? sprzedawcy kas?

Postaw piwo autorowi tego posta
 

 
Wysłany: 2012-05-23, 19:16


Piorun







Wiek: 32
Na forum: 6712 dni
Posty: 1837
Nick w MP: Piorun

Piwa: 516

Respekt: 480,7
Respekt: 480,7

Czyli dok?adnie to samo co napisa?em oO.

Podpis
Możesz mnie znaleźć na: Facebook
Postaw piwo autorowi tego posta
 

 
Wysłany: 2012-05-24, 12:57


luki123luki123

Place Game






Wiek: 28
Na forum: 5275 dni
Posty: 1948
Nick w MP: LuKiO

Piwa: 6101

Respekt: 611
Respekt: 611Respekt: 611

Pioruniasty, tak

[ Dodano: 2012-05-24, 15:05 ]
Zrobi?em na szybko



Salon_Window = {}
Salon_Button = {}
Salon_Grid = {}

Salon_Window[1] = guiCreateWindow(405,58,456,685,"Panel Salonu",false)
guiSetVisible(Salon_Window[1], false)
Salon_Grid[1] = guiCreateGridList(16,22,228,653,false,Salon_Window[1])
guiGridListSetSelectionMode(Salon_Grid[1],2)
local kolumna guiGridListAddColumn(Salon_Grid[1],"Gracze",0.9)
Salon_Grid[2] = guiCreateGridList(248,25,199,510,false,Salon_Window[1])
guiGridListSetSelectionMode(Salon_Grid[2],2)
local kolumna1 guiGridListAddColumn(Salon_Grid[2],"Auta",0.9)
Salon_Button[1] = guiCreateButton(250,625,197,51,"Wyjdz",false,Salon_Window[1])
Salon_Button[2] = guiCreateButton(251,545,196,49,"Sprzedaj",false,Salon_Window[1])


bindKey("k""down", 
function ()
    if (getPlayerTeam(getLocalPlayer()) == getTeamFromName("P")) then
        if (guiGetVisible(Salon_Window[1]) == falsethen
            showCursor(true)
            guiSetVisible(Salon_Window[1], true)
            if (kolumnathen
                for idplayer in ipairs(getElementsByType("player")) do
                    local row guiGridListAddRow(Salon_Grid[1])
                    guiGridListSetItemText(Salon_Grid[1], rowkolumnagetPlayerName(player), falsefalse)
                end
            end
        else
            guiSetVisible(Salon_Window[1], false)
            showCursor(false)
            guiGridListClear(Salon_Grid[1])
        end
    end
end)


[ Dodano: 2012-05-24, 15:20 ]
EDIT@1

Salon_Window = {}
Salon_Button = {}
Salon_Grid = {}

Salon_Window[1] = guiCreateWindow(405,58,456,685,"Panel Salonu",false)
guiSetVisible(Salon_Window[1], false)
Salon_Grid[1] = guiCreateGridList(16,22,228,653,false,Salon_Window[1])
guiGridListSetSelectionMode(Salon_Grid[1],2)
local kolumna guiGridListAddColumn(Salon_Grid[1],"Gracze",0.9)
Salon_Grid[2] = guiCreateGridList(248,25,199,510,false,Salon_Window[1])
guiGridListSetSelectionMode(Salon_Grid[2],2)
local kolumna1 guiGridListAddColumn(Salon_Grid[2],"Auta",0.9)
Salon_Button[1] = guiCreateButton(250,625,197,51,"Wyjdz",false,Salon_Window[1])
Salon_Button[2] = guiCreateButton(251,545,196,49,"Sprzedaj",false,Salon_Window[1])


bindKey("k""down", 
function ()
    if (getPlayerTeam(getLocalPlayer()) == getTeamFromName("P")) then
        if (guiGetVisible(Salon_Window[1]) == falsethen
            showCursor(true)
            guiSetVisible(Salon_Window[1], true)
            if (kolumnathen
                for idplayer in ipairs(getElementsByType("player")) do
                    local row guiGridListAddRow(Salon_Grid[1])
                    guiGridListSetItemText(Salon_Grid[1], rowkolumnagetPlayerName(player), falsefalse)
                end
            end
        else
            guiSetVisible(Salon_Window[1], false)
            showCursor(false)
            guiGridListClear(Salon_Grid[1])
        end
    end
end)


function sprzedaj()
    local player guiGridListGetItemText (Salon_Grid[1], guiGridListGetSelectedItem (Salon_Grid[1]), )
    local car guiGridListGetItemText (Salon_Grid[2], guiGridListGetSelectedItem (Salon_Grid[2]), )
    if player ~= "" then
        if car ~= "" then
            local id getVehicleModelFromName(car)
            local kasa getCarKoszt(id)
            if id and kasa then
                dajCar(player,id,kasa,score)
            else
                outputChatBox("Wyst?pi? b??d w skrypcie",255,0,0)
            end
        else
            outputChatBox("Zaznacz Auto!",255,0,0)
        end
    else
        outputChatBox("Zaznacz Gracza!",255,0,0)
    end
end


function dajAuto(player,id,kasa)
    if getTickCount() - sprzedane 5000 then
        triggerServerEvent("salon:dajAuto"getLocalPlayer(),player,id,kasa)
        sprzedane getTickCount()
    else
        outputChatBox("Nie mo?na tak szybko sprzedawa? aut.",255,0,0)
    end
end


Postaw piwo autorowi tego posta
 

 
Wysłany: 2012-05-24, 16:50


Piorun







Wiek: 32
Na forum: 6712 dni
Posty: 1837
Nick w MP: Piorun

Piwa: 516

Respekt: 480,7
Respekt: 480,7

Tutaj masz wszystkie potrzebne Ci funkcje:
http://wiki.multitheftaut...s#XML_functions

Podpis
Możesz mnie znaleźć na: Facebook
Postaw piwo autorowi tego posta
 

 
Wysłany: 2012-05-24, 17:18


Jacob

Głupiomądry






Wiek: 28
Na forum: 5502 dni
Posty: 967
Nick w MP: Jacob

Piwa: 786

Respekt: 212,3
Respekt: 212,3Respekt: 212,3

Poza tym, kod czytany jest od g?ry do do?u, wi?c co? wywnioskuj z tego. Znam Twoje umiej?tno?ci, to nie jest w pe?ni Tw?j kod.

Postaw piwo autorowi tego posta
 

 
Wysłany: 2012-05-26, 09:47


luki123luki123

Place Game






Wiek: 28
Na forum: 5275 dni
Posty: 1948
Nick w MP: LuKiO

Piwa: 6101

Respekt: 611
Respekt: 611Respekt: 611

Nie wychodzi mi bo nie wiem jak to zrobi? da kto? przyk?ad

Postaw piwo autorowi tego posta
 

 
Tagi: panel :: salonu
Anonymous





Na forum: 245 dni
Posty: 1



Anonymous Koniecznie zajrzyj na:






Skocz do:  
Wyświetl posty z ostatnich:   
GTAONLINE.PL » JĘZYKI PROGRAMOWANIA » LUA » Panel salonu Ten temat jest zablokowany bez możliwości zmiany postów lub pisania odpowiedzi

Nie możesz pisać nowych tematów
Nie możesz odpowiadać w tematach
Nie możesz zmieniać swoich postów
Nie możesz usuwać swoich postów
Nie możesz głosować w ankietach
Dodaj temat do Ulubionych
Wersja do druku